Definizione
Too careful about manners or rules in an annoying way.
Too concerned with correct manners, appearance, or what is considered proper, in a way that seems fussy or self-righteous; often used disapprovingly.

Definizione
Too neat and delicate in style.
Having an overly neat, delicate, or fussy look that seems affected or overly careful.
